/*
* @lc app=leetcode.cn id=104 lang=java
*
* [104] 二叉树的最大深度
*/
// @lc code=start
/**
* Definition for a binary tree node.
* public class TreeNode {
* int val;
* TreeNode left;
* TreeNode right;
* TreeNode(int x) { val = x; }
* }
*/
class Solution {
public int maxDepth(TreeNode root) {
if (root == null) {return 0;}
Queue<TreeNode> queue = new LinkedList<TreeNode>();
Set<TreeNode> set = new HashSet();
int depth = 0;
queue.add(root);
while (!queue.isEmpty()) {
TreeNode currNode = queue.poll();
set.add(currNode);
if (queue.isEmpty() && set.size() > 0) {
depth++;
set.forEach((tmpNode) -> {
if (tmpNode.left != null) {
((LinkedList<TreeNode>) queue).add(tmpNode.left);
}
if (tmpNode.right != null) {
((LinkedList<TreeNode>) queue).add(tmpNode.right);
}
});
set.clear();
}
}
return depth;
}
}
// @lc code=end
